Output 276b8bd966c0a1d672ac6524a2cf15f870dc63cdc7f0731104e8e7e28521cebe: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95b3613c2b55f3a855a89cce43eefb7996b41f4 OP_EQUAL
address
3L3h1ZzauhVL2cUVWtpKUXNHJHcr64idK3
transaction
276b8bd966c0a1d672ac6524a2cf15f870dc63cdc7f0731104e8e7e28521cebe
spent
true